英文摘要
Primary samples from patients with leukemia were successfully engrafted into mice, and those engrafted leukemic cells were able to be serially transplanted into secondary, tertiary recipients. Morphological and FACS analyses revealed as high as >80% blood chimerism and conserved blast phenotypes through serial transplantations. Moreover, extramedullary organs including liver, spleen and kidney showed the leukemic invasion consistent with donor disease. Immunohistological analysis of liver revealed that SDF-1 was detectable only in bile duct epithelial cells. In addition, we demonstrated directly the effect of SDF-1/CXCR4 axis in our model by using the CXCR4 inhibitor both in vivo and in vitro. Our study on the involvement of SDF-1/CXCR4 axis in liver could rink to the novel therapies which target the extramedullary sites in order to perfectly overcome leukemia.
